Quiz question. What was the first TV series to be turned into a feature-length movie? You’d have to go back to the 1950s and a hit detective series for the answer.

Dragnet had started on the radio in the US, became essential TV viewing, and, in 1954, moved onto the big screen. A classic multimedia franchise. Small-screen shows have continued to inspire movies ever since, from The Untouchables (on TV from 1959 to 1963, with the film released in 1989) to the more recent Downton Abbey, which draws to an elegant close this year with The Grand Finale. But it’s not just big shows that make the transition. Tucked away on Netflix is The Unforgivable (2021), a film that started life in 2009 on British television as a mini-series, The Unforgiven.
